[0001] The utility model relates to power adapter technical field, concretely relates to a conversion head for power adapter. BACKGROUND

[0002] Power adapter is the power supply conversion equipment of small portable electronic equipment and electronic appliances, generally by shell, transformer, inductor, capacitor, control IC, PCB board etc. Component composition, its work principle is by AC input conversion DC output, can be divided into wall type and desktop type according to connection mode. It is widely matched in security camera, set top box, router, light bar, massager etc. Equipment.

[0003] The existing power adapter needs to replace different conversion heads when using to serve different electronic equipment, but the existing conversion head is generally connected with the adapter through threads, but the thread connection encounters loosening or slip silk condition, and the circuit connection place can appear gap, thereby affecting the use of the conversion head. DETAILED DESCRIPTION

[0029] The preferred embodiments of the utility model are described below in combination with the drawings, and it should be understood that the preferred embodiments described herein are only used for illustrating and explaining the utility model, and are not used for limiting the utility model.

[0030] Referring to the drawings Figure 1 - the utility model provides a conversion head for power adapter, including adapter body 1, adapter body 1 top is equipped with line connection pipe 2; Figure 5

[0031] Conversion head body 3, conversion head body 3 is located in line connection pipe 2 top;

[0032] Mounting mechanism, mounting mechanism is located in line connection pipe 2 bottom, and mounting mechanism is used to install conversion head body 3;

[0033] Line connection head 4, line connection head 4 is fixedly arranged in conversion head body 3 bottom;

[0034] Line connection port 5, line connection port 5 is arranged in line connection pipe 2 inside, line connection port 5 is connected with line connection head 4, line connection port 5 bottom is connected with connecting line 6, and connecting line 6 extends to adapter body 1 inside;

[0035] In the embodiment, multiple positioning blocks 14 are embedded into positioning sleeve 10 inside by the user, at this time, elastic sheet 17 is embedded into limiting groove 16 inside, the user rotates elastic sheet 17, limiting groove 16 limits elastic sheet 17, so that conversion head body 3 position is fixed, and simultaneously connecting end head and connecting port are tightly connected;

[0036] ​Wherein, in order to realize the purpose of the conversion head installation, the device uses the following technical solutions to realize: the installation mechanism includes a positioning plate 7, the positioning plate 7 is embedded in the inside of the line connecting pipe 2, the positioning plate 7 is fixedly sleeved outside the line connecting port 5, the line connecting pipe 2 is embedded with a movable pipe 8 inside, the movable pipe 8 is sleeved outside the positioning plate 7, the movable pipe 8 is movably connected with the positioning plate 7 through the rolling bearing, a plurality of support rods 9 are fixedly connected to the top of the movable pipe 8, a plurality of positioning sleeves 10 are fixedly connected to the top of the plurality of support rods 9, a threaded pipe 11 is fixedly embedded in the inside of the line connecting pipe 2, the threaded pipe 11 is sleeved outside the movable pipe 8, the threaded pipe 11 is connected with the movable pipe 8 through the thread, a connecting ring 12 is arranged on the top of the line connecting pipe 2, the connecting ring 12 is fixedly connected to the top of the threaded pipe 11, a fixed ring 13 is fixedly connected to the bottom of the line connecting head 4, a plurality of positioning blocks 14 are fixedly connected to the bottom of the fixed ring 13, the plurality of positioning blocks 14 are matched with the plurality of positioning sleeves 10 respectively, a limiting frame 15 is fixedly connected to the top of the connecting ring 12, a limiting groove 16 is arranged on one side of the limiting frame 15, a spring piece 17 is arranged on one side of the fixed ring 13, the spring piece 17 is made of plastic material, a spring 18 is fixedly connected to the top of the spring piece 17, and the top end of the spring 18 is fixedly connected with the body of the conversion head 3.

[0037] The user embeds the plurality of positioning blocks 14 into the plurality of positioning sleeves 10, at this time, the user presses the spring piece 17 downward, so that the spring piece 17 moves downward and is embedded into the limiting groove 16, and then the user rotates the body of the conversion head 3, when the body of the conversion head 3 is rotated to the maximum limit, the user releases the spring piece 17, due to the elastic force of the spring 18, the spring piece 17 is lifted, so that the position of the body of the conversion head 3 is fixed, and the effect of positioning and installation is achieved, and when the body of the conversion head 3 rotates, the positioning sleeve 10 and the movable pipe 8 are driven to rotate, the movable pipe 8 is connected with the threaded pipe 11 through the thread, so that when the movable pipe 8 rotates in the threaded pipe 11, the movable pipe 8 moves upward, and the movable pipe 8 drives the positioning plate 7 and the line connecting port 5 to move upward, so that the line connecting port 5 is clamped with the line connecting head 4, and the effect of close connection is achieved.

[0038] Wherein, in order to realize the purpose of the limiting, the device uses the following technical solutions to realize: two lifting grooves are arranged on the inner wall of the connecting pipe, the two lifting grooves are arranged at the bottom of the threaded pipe 11, lifting rods 19 are fixedly connected on both sides of the line connecting port 5, the outer ends of the two lifting rods 19 extend into the two lifting grooves respectively, and the lifting rods 19 slide in the lifting grooves.

[0039] The design of the lifting groove and the lifting rod 19 makes the line connecting port 5 only move up and down, and does not rotate by itself.

[0040] The use process of the utility model is as follows: a plurality of positioning blocks 14 are embedded into the positioning sleeves 10 by the user, at this time the elastic sheet 17 is embedded into the limiting groove 16, the user rotates the elastic sheet 17, the limiting groove 16 limits the elastic sheet 17, the conversion head body 3 position is fixed, and the connecting end head is tightly connected with the connecting port; the user embeds a plurality of positioning blocks 14 into a plurality of positioning sleeves 10, at this time the user presses the elastic sheet 17 downwards, the elastic sheet 17 is embedded into the limiting groove 16, then the conversion head body 3 is rotated, when the conversion head body 3 is rotated to the maximum limit, the user releases the elastic sheet 17, due to the elastic force of the spring 18, the elastic sheet 17 is lifted, so that the conversion head body 3 position is fixed, the positioning installation effect is achieved, when the conversion head body 3 rotates, the positioning sleeve 10 and the movable pipe 8 are rotated, the movable pipe 8 and the threaded pipe 11 are connected through threads, so that the movable pipe 8 is moved upwards when rotating in the threaded pipe 11, the movable pipe 8 moves upwards and drives the positioning plate 7 and the line connecting port 5 to move upwards, so that the line connecting port 5 is clamped with the line connecting head 4, the tightly connected effect is achieved, the design of the lifting groove and the lifting rod 19 makes the line connecting port 5 only move upwards and downwards, and the line connecting port 5 does not rotate.
